Buying Guide
What should I consider when choosing incense to keep bugs away?
Burn time and coverage: Look for sticks or cones with burn times that fit your gathering length. Longer burn times per stick allow fewer interruptions in outdoor events. Consider how many sticks you’ll need to create an effective perimeter for your space.
Ingredients and safety: Plant-based oils like citronella, lemongrass, rosemary, and peppermint are common. If you have pets or kids, prioritize DEET-free and non-toxic formulations and verify the product’s safety disclosures.
Format and setup: Incense sticks require holders or stable surfaces. Cones and ceramic dishes offer quick setup with minimal equipment, while sticks may demand more spacing to avoid smoke in seating areas.
Outdoor conditions: Wind and humidity affect burn time and effectiveness. In windy spaces, use more sticks and place them downwind of seating areas to maximize fragrance and protection.
Perimeter strategy: Plan a perimeter around your activity area. For patios, place sticks at regular intervals (roughly 8–12 feet apart) to create a continuous barrier. For smaller spaces, fewer sticks may suffice but ensure even coverage.

How should I position incense for best protection?
Place sticks or cones at even intervals around the perimeter of your outdoor area. Maintain a balance so that the smoke rises over seating and walking paths rather than directly into faces. Use stands or stakes to elevate the source slightly off the ground for steadier burn and better dispersed aroma.
Are there any safety tips I should follow?
Always burn incense in a well-ventilated outdoor space. Keep flames away from flammable materials and never leave burning items unattended. Use heat-safe holders and place sticks in sturdy sand or soil when not burning. For families with children or pets, verify the product’s safety data and supervise use accordingly.
What if I have mixed bug concerns (flies, gnats, no-see-ums)?
Multi-oil blends with citronella, rosemary, and lemongrass tend to deter a broader range of pests. For heavy fly or gnat activity, combine incense use with other measures such as fans, proper trash management, and screened seating areas to enhance overall outdoor comfort.
